How to Use the Whole Language Approach.
Ross, Elinor P.
Adult Learning, v1 n2 p23-24,27,29 Oct 1989
Techniques for using the whole language approach include read-aloud sessions, student story dictation, practice in using decoding skills, word banks, and exercises that stress the connection between reading and writing. The method considers individual needs and interests, offers relevance, and builds on adults' experiences. (SK)
